Position Overview
We are seeking an experienced Structural Bridge Engineer – Project Manager to support and grow our Transportation Practice in our Charlotte, North Carolina office.
Key Responsibilities- Responsible for management, scope, fees, and the profitability of individual projects and project portfolio.
- Point person and firm’s contact with clients while functioning as project manager.
- Assists in new sales with clients for which they are managing projects.
- Guides and coordinates internal LJB transportation disciplines with sub-consultants and clients.
- Experience managing multidisciplinary teams.
- Possesses an understanding of all transportation disciplines and requirements as related to bridge design projects.
- Responsible for assisting Deputy Operations Manager in maintaining PM best practices.
- On larger projects, may or may not be involved directly in the design.
- Apprise Operations Management of employee performance on projects.
- Provide information to Deputy Operations Manager on future projects so they can manage staffing.
- Assist in informal development of other employees.
- Other duties as assigned.
- Bachelor’s degree in civil engineering or related field required; M.S. degree in a relevant discipline is preferred.
- P.E. license required.
- Certified as a Project Management Professional (PMP) a plus.
- At least 10 years of experience in consulting or engineering.
- Experience working with DOTs required.
- Project team leadership experience.
- Project and client management experience.
- Strong presentation and interpersonal communications skills.
- Excellent writing, editing, and verbal communication skills required.
- Micro Station, Open Roads, AutoCAD, and Civil‑3D software experience is preferred.
Annual Compensation: $95,000 – 185,000 based upon experience, certifications, and regional market standards.
